toppack
03-27-2009, 12:47 PM
Altho the smaller one will probably do the job, I would always use the large one, as long as it and it's E-switch will fit in the SD used. (use the small one in small sub-drivers)
That way you will always have Maximum air, when needed.
Those 2 website pages show the same 2 pumps.
The one with the lowest price, looks best to me. :D
Deciding which E-switch to use, to turn it off/on, can be the the most difficult decision to make. ;) But that also is decided mainly by space available and cost.
(Max motor current is important of couse.)
